While North Carolina isn't quite the Goliath they have been in the past, Michigan did have to go into Chapel Hill and face the #12 team in the nation with what's been a suspect offense at best. It didn't turn out all that well. Michigan was swept on the weekend, losing two extremely close games on Friday and Saturday, and was blown out on Sunday to fall to 4-7 on the season. Detroit Cass Tech head coach Thomas Wilcher has sent his players to schools like Michigan, Ohio State, LSU and Oregon over the years, but now he is helping with the recruitment of his own son. After more performances like the one this past weekend, however, athlete Kishon Wilcher may not need much help attracting colleges.

The Michigan basketball team essentially has one option to play in the postseason this year - win the Big Ten Tournament and go to the Big Dance. "We do not have an interest in that tournament" head coach John Beilein responded when asked if the Wolverines would consider an option like the postseason CBI.
